Story
Meet Oscar! He is an incredibly resilient 9-year-old whose determination shines through every single day. When Oscar came to SBR, he had lost the use of his back legs. His family loved him very much but made the heartbreaking decision to surrender him because they could no longer afford the specialized medical care he needed. Just two days after arriving at SBR, Oscar underwent spinal surgery. While the neurologist repaired what could be addressed, much of what was discovered were chronic, long-standing changes to his spine. His journey isn't over, but it is filled with hope. Oscar has begun physical therapy and is working hard to learn to walk again. His neurological team is optimistic that he will regain the ability to walk, although his gait will likely never be completely normal. If you've ever met a determined basset, you'll understand Oscar perfectly—he's stubborn in all the best ways and refuses to let anything slow him down! Despite everything he's been through, Oscar remains one of the sweetest boys you'll ever meet. He gets along well with his foster sisters (as long as they don't come racing past him!), absolutely loves squeaky toys, and still tries his best to "chase" the lizards that visit the patio. His joyful spirit and zest for life are truly inspiring. Oscar still has more medical care ahead of him, including a much-needed dental procedure and neuter surgery. For now, however, his focus—and ours—is helping him regain his mobility and continue making progress one step at a time. Oscar's story is one of resilience, perseverance, and hope. We can't wait to watch him continue proving that, with love, determination, and the right care, amazing things are possible.
